Perfect Square
209793782359143614510482045494714598866819970161 is a perfect square (458032512338527792537881 × 458032512338527792537881)
209793782359143614510482045494714598866819970161 is a perfect square (458032512338527792537881 × 458032512338527792537881)
209793782359143614510482045494714598866819970161 is odd
Previous odd number is 209793782359143614510482045494714598866819970159
Next odd number is 209793782359143614510482045494714598866819970163
10010010111111011110101000001100000000100001010101010100010101111011111101110000101011100010010010111100000010110101111111001000010100110010110111010001110001
9233744188545849729251385802739937996837742022427634910749833187668214638178342042294590496916680226788653463987528541010049294410356031283281
44013431116555718467592349778518203076526508350054600832507820069211109394519081225916930365921